Beef Stir-Fry Noodles
A quick and satisfying weeknight stir-fry with tender beef, crisp vegetables, and chewy noodles in a savory soy sauce.
- Total time
- 30 min
- Servings
- 2
- Calories
- 550
- Protein
- 35g

Ingredients
- ½ lb beef sirloin, thinly sliced
- 3 tbsp soy sauce
- 8 oz cooked noodles (lo mein or spaghetti)
- 1 medium carrot, julienned
- 1 medium red bell pepper, sliced
- 4 oz snow peas
- 3 stalks green onions, sliced
- 2 tbsp vegetable oil
Instructions
- 1
In a bowl, toss the 0.5 lb beef with 1 tbsp soy sauce and let marinate for 10 minutes while you prep vegetables.
- 2
Heat 1 tbsp v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over high heat until shimmering. Add the beef in a single layer and cook without stirring for 1-2 minutes until browned, then stir-fry for another 1-2 minutes until just cooked through. Remove beef to a plate.
- 3
Add the remaining 1 tbsp oil to the skillet. Add the 1 julienned carrot, 1 sliced bell pepper, and 4 oz snow peas. Stir-fry over high heat until crisp-tender, about 3-4 minutes.
- 4
Add the 8 oz cooked noodles and the remaining 2 tbsp soy sauce. Toss everything together for 2-3 minutes until noodles are heated through and coated.
- 5
Return the beef to the skillet, add the 3 sliced green onions, and toss for 1 minute until everything is combined and hot. Serve immediately.
- 6
Optional: sprinkle with sesame seeds or chili flakes for extra flavor.
